Brad Paisley released a song called Hard Life in 2011, The tune was written by Joe Kindregan, a 23-year-old Virginia native who has A-T (ataxia-telangiectasia), a fatal disease that combines symptoms of cystic fibrosis, muscular dystrophy, immune deficiencies and cancer. Joe met Brad back in 2005 at a fundraiser for Team 25, which helps kids facing tremendous health challenges like his. The two sang on stage together at the event and have kept in touch through the years.
